5A Municipal fire prevention officers and assistants
S. 5A(1) amended by No. 20/2019 s. 63.
(1) Each municipal council, the municipal district or part of the municipal district of which is in the Fire Rescue Victoria fire district—
(a) must appoint a person to be the fire prevention officer for that council for the purposes of this Act;
(b) may appoint any number of persons it thinks fit to be assistant fire prevention officers.
(2) A fire prevention officer may, by written instrument, delegate to an assistant fire prevention officer, either generally or as otherwise provided in the instrument, any power or duty of the fire prevention officer under this Act or the regulations except this power of delegation.

6 Fire Rescue Victoria
(1) Fire Rescue Victoria is established by this section.
(2) Fire Rescue Victoria is constituted by the Fire Rescue Commissioner.
(3) Fire Rescue Victoria—
(a) is a body corporate with perpetual succession; and
(b) must have an official seal; and
(c) may sue and be sued in its corporate name; and
(d) may acquire, hold and dispose of real and personal property for the purpose of performing its functions; and
(e) may do and suffer all acts and things that bodies corporate may by law do and suffer and that are necessary or incidental for the performance of its functions.

7 Functions of Fire Rescue Victoria
S. 7(1) amended by No. 20/2019 s. 28(1).
(1) The functions of Fire Rescue Victoria are—
S. 7(1)(a) amended by Nos 5/2012 s. 62(1), 20/2019 s. 64(1).
(a) to provide for fire suppression and fire prevention services in the Fire Rescue Victoria fire district; and
S. 7(1)(b) amended by Nos 5/2012 s. 62(1), 20/2019 s. 64(1).
(b) to provide for emergency prevention and response services in the Fire Rescue Victoria fire district; and
S. 7(1)(ba) inserted by No. 20/2019 s. 28(2).
(ba) to implement the fire and emergency services priorities of the Government of Victoria; and
S. 7(1)(bb) inserted by No. 20/2019 s. 28(2).
(bb) to provide operational and management support to the Country Fire Authority in consultation with and as agreed by the Authority, to meet the Authority's objective under section 6B of the **Country Fire Authority Act 1958**, including support to maintain, strengthen and encourage the capability of volunteers; and
S. 7(1)(c) amended by Nos 5/2012 s. 62(2), 20/2019 s. 28(1).
(c) to carry out any other functions conferred on Fire Rescue Victoria by or under this Act or the regulations or any other Act or any regulations under that Act.
S. 7(2) amended by No. 20/2019 s. 28(3).
(2) Fire Rescue Victoria has all powers necessary to carry out its functions.
S. 7(3) amended by Nos 5/2012 s. 62(3), 20/2019 ss 28(4), 64(2).
(3) The functions of Fire Rescue Victoria extend to any vessel berthed adjacent to land which by virtue of section 4(2) is part of the Fire Rescue Victoria fire district.

7AA Duty to assist in major emergency
S. 7AA(1) amended by No. 20/2019 s. 29(1).
(1) In addition to any other of its duties and functions under this Act, Fire Rescue Victoria must assist in the response to any major emergency occurring within Victoria.
(2) In this section—
S. 7AA(2) def. of *emergency agency* amended by No. 20/2019 s. 29(2).
***emergency agency*** means—
(a) Fire Rescue Victoria;
(b) the Country Fire Authority established under the **Country Fire Authority Act 1958**;
(c) the Secretary to the Department of Sustainability and Environment when performing functions or duties or exercising powers under section 62(2) of the **Forests Act 1958**;
(d) the Victoria State Emergency Service Authority established under the **Victoria State Emergency Service Act 2005**;
S. 7AA(2) def. of *major emergency* amended by No. 73/2013 s. 90(b).
***major emergency means***—
(a) a large or complex emergency (however caused) which—
(i) has the potential to cause or is causing loss of life and extensive damage to property, infrastructure or the environment; or
(ii) has the potential to have or is having significant adverse consequences for the Victorian community or a part of the Victorian community; or
(iii) requires the involvement of 2 or more emergency agencies to respond to the emergency; or
(b) a major fire within the meaning of the **Emergency Management Act 2013**.

7A Objective
The objective of Fire Rescue Victoria in performing its functions and exercising its powers under this Act is to—
(a) contribute to a whole of sector approach to emergency management;
(b) promote a culture within the emergency management sector of community focus, interoperability and public value.
S. 7AB inserted by No. 73/2013 s. 89, amended by No. 20/2019 s. 31.
7AB Emergency Management Victoria
Fire Rescue Victoria must, in performing its functions and exercising its powers, collaborate and consult with Emergency Management Victoria.
S. 7AC inserted by No. 73/2013 s. 89, amended by No. 20/2019 s. 32.
7AC Compliance with operational standards of Emergency Management Commissioner
Fire Rescue Victoria must use its best endeavours to carry out its functions in accordance with the operational standards developed by the Emergency Management Commissioner under the **Emergency Management Act 2013**.
S. 7AD inserted by No. 73/2013 s. 89.
7AD Report on compliance with operational standards developed by the Emergency Management Commissioner
S. 7AD(1) amended by No. 20/2019 s. 33(1).
(1) Fire Rescue Victoria must, at the expiration of each period of 6 months, report in writing on the action it has taken during the preceding 6 months to comply with the operational standards developed by the Emergency Management Commissioner under the **Emergency Management Act 2013**.
S. 7AD(2) amended by No. 20/2019 s. 33(2).
(2) A copy of the report prepared by Fire Rescue Victoria under subsection (1) must be given to the Emergency Management Commissioner.
S. 7AE inserted by No. 73/2013 s. 89.
7AE Strategic Action Plan
S. 7AE(1) amended by No. 20/2019 s. 34(1).
(1) Fire Rescue Victoria must implement the applicable work program to give effect to the Strategic Action Plan.
S. 7AE(2) amended by No. 20/2019 s. 34(1)(2).
(2) Fire Rescue Victoria must prepare a written report on the progress made, and achievements attained, by Fire Rescue Victoria to give effect to the Strategic Action Plan at intervals determined by the State Crisis and Resilience Council.
(3) The intervals must not be less than one a year.
S. 7AE(4) amended by No. 20/2019 s. 34(1)(3).
(4) Fire Rescue Victoria must give a copy of a report prepared by Fire Rescue Victoria under subsection (2) to the State Crisis and Resilience Council and the Inspector-General for Emergency Management.
